Received 27 December 1996; published in the issue dated 28 April 1997
Using data collected with the CLEO II detector at the Cornell Electron Storage Ring, we present new measurements of the branching fractions for D+→KSK+ and D+→KSπ+. These results are combined with other CLEO measurements to extract the ratios of isospin amplitudes and phase shifts for D→KK and D→Kπ.
